Meaning & origin

Brayln is a modern American invention that first appeared on the U.S. Social Security baby names list in 2008. It reached its peak popularity in 2013, when the name was given to the most boys in a single year. Since then, its usage has remained stable at low levels. The name did not achieve a national ranking or a one-in-N rate, indicating it was never widely used. Brayln fits squarely within the 2010s naming trend of creating new names by adding the suffix -lyn to familiar sounds like Bray (from Brayden or Braxton). Its top states were not recorded, meaning usage was scattered and did not concentrate regionally. As a modern coinage, Brayln carries no traditional meaning or cultural origin, reflecting a purely stylistic choice.

Brayln is a modern invention, part of the trend creating new names by adding the fashionable suffix -lyn to existing sounds or names like Brayden or Braxton. It first appeared in U.S. records in 2008, reflecting the early 21st century popularity of similar coinages.
